I was browsing through rcdb, and came across a new Intamin ride, set for 2003 at Särkänniemi Amusement Park. The name of the ride is Halfpipe, and from that name one would assume that it's an Impulse. It is indeed an LIM Shuttle, but the train descriptions don't fit. It also doesn't say anything about it being inverted.

Here's the link.

http://www.rcdb.com/installationdetail1826.htm

Särkänniemi Amusement Park is the park that gave us Tornado, Intamin's first full circuit inverter. Will this be another first from Särkänniemi amd Intamin...?

BullGuy said: Särkänniemi Amusement Park is the park that gave us Tornado, Intamin's first full circuit inverter.

Whoops! Did we forget about Volcano so soon? Remember, it opened in '98. What about Tornado at Parque de Atracciones in Spain? It opened in '99.

Tornado at Särkänniemi opened in 2001.. so it was the 3rd of the bunch. Sorry, but that was one nit I *had* to pick. ;)
